History of Cape Porpoise Lecture

September 17th at 7pm

Located at the Town House School

135 North St. in Kennebunkport

Discover the rich history of Cape Porpoise, one of Kennebunkport’s most iconic fishing villages. This engaging lecture explores the area’s evolution from one of the region’s earliest settlements into the vibrant harbor community it is today, highlighting the fishermen, families, islands, landmarks, and local traditions that have shaped its unique character over the centuries.

Through historic photographs and fascinating stories, you’ll gain a deeper appreciation for the people, industries, and events that helped define Cape Porpoise’s enduring maritime heritage. Whether you’re a longtime resident, seasonal visitor, or simply interested in local history, this presentation offers a captivating look at one of Kennebunkport’s most treasured communities.
